Disneyland Group Rates and Group Ticket Discounts

Disneyland does offer group ticket discounts, but simply bringing a large group of family or friends does not qualify you for a group rate. Disneyland’s specially priced group tickets are primarily available through Disney Imagination Campus for qualifying student and youth groups and through Disney Meetings & Events for business meetings, conventions and events.

For student and youth groups, the current minimum is 10 qualifying students ages 3 to 22. Disneyland student tickets currently start at $121 per student for eligible 2026 value-season dates.

If you’re planning a family reunion or a trip with 10, 12 or even 15 friends and relatives, there is currently no automatic Disneyland group discount based only on the number of tickets you’re buying.

Who Qualifies for Disneyland Group Rates?

Disneyland currently directs guests looking for specially priced group admission into two main programs.

Type of groupGroup rate?How it works
School or qualifying youth organizationYesDisney Imagination Campus
Business meeting, convention or eventYesDisney Meetings & Events
Family reunionNo automatic group discountBuy regular tickets and check current promotions
Large group of friendsNo automatic group discountBuy regular tickets and check current promotions
Several families traveling togetherNo automatic group discountCompare regular tickets and available discounts

This is important because “group ticket” doesn’t simply mean purchasing a lot of Disneyland tickets in one transaction. Disney bases the special pricing on the type of organization or event.

Disneyland Student Group Ticket Prices

Disney Imagination Campus currently offers specially priced Disneyland tickets to qualifying student and youth groups.

For 2026, Disneyland student tickets currently start at $121 per student for a 1-Day, 1 Park ticket on qualifying value-season dates through December 11, 2026.

The actual price depends on the dates, number of park days and ticket type your group chooses.

Disney also offers multi-day and Park Hopper options, so $121 should be treated as the current starting price rather than the price every student group will pay.

How Many People Do You Need for a Disneyland Student Group?

For Disney Student Tickets, you currently need a minimum of 10 students between ages 3 and 22.

The group must also come from a qualifying organization. Disney lists accredited schools, religious organizations and other organized youth groups among the types of groups that can qualify.

So a group of 10 children and young adults traveling together as friends would not automatically qualify just because they meet the age and headcount requirements. Disney reviews the organization for eligibility.

Do Chaperones Get Disneyland Group Tickets?

Eligible Disney Imagination Campus groups can receive complimentary chaperone tickets.

The number of complimentary chaperone tickets depends on the ticket product, group size and Disney’s destination-specific requirements, so I would confirm the exact allowance while arranging the group reservation.

How Far Ahead Do Student Groups Need to Book?

Disney currently requires Disneyland Student Tickets to be purchased and paid in full at least 60 days before the visit, although Disney notes that exceptions may sometimes apply.

This is not a ticket type I would leave until the week before the trip.

Disney currently accepts organizational credit cards, checks, cashier’s checks, money orders, ACH and wire transfers for these bookings. Disney Gift Cards and personal checks are not accepted for Disney Student Ticket orders.

Theme park reservations are also required for Disneyland student tickets for the same date and starting park as the admission.

Disneyland Group Rates for Business Meetings and Conventions

The other major Disneyland group-ticket program is Disney Meetings & Events.

This program is intended for business meetings, conferences, conventions, corporate events and other organized functions at or associated with the Disneyland Resort.

Disney currently says meeting and event attendees can receive specially priced Disneyland theme park tickets. Family and friends traveling with attendees may also have access to the specially priced ticket options offered through the event.

Disney does not publish one universal Disneyland business group ticket price. Pricing depends on the specific meeting or event, so you’ll need to work with Disney Meetings & Events for the available ticket options.

Does a Family of 10 Get a Disneyland Group Discount?

No. Disneyland does not currently give a normal family or friend group a discount simply because 10 people are buying tickets.

Disney confirmed this again in 2026 when a guest asked specifically about buying Disneyland tickets for a group of 10.

A group of 10 can still use any regular Disneyland promotion for which its individual members qualify, but there isn’t a standard volume discount for buying 10 tickets together.

What About a Group of 12 or 15 People?

The same rule applies.

A family reunion with 12 people, a birthday trip with 15 friends or several families traveling together does not automatically become eligible for Disneyland group pricing.

The group would need to qualify under one of Disney’s applicable programs, such as an eligible student organization or business event, for the special group-ticket programs discussed above.

Otherwise, I would compare normal Disneyland ticket promotions and established ticket sellers rather than trying to reach an arbitrary group-size threshold.

How Do You Buy Disneyland Tickets for a Large Family Group?

If you’re simply organizing a large family or friend trip, you can still buy regular Disneyland tickets without using a special group program.

Disney currently allows up to 10 adult tickets and 5 child tickets in a transaction through the Disneyland website or mobile app. If the makeup of your party exceeds what the online system allows in one purchase, you may need to divide the tickets among transactions or contact Disneyland Ticket Services for assistance.

Buying tickets separately does not prevent your group from visiting together. Each guest still needs valid admission and the required theme park reservation for the date you’re visiting.

Are Disneyland Group Tickets Always the Cheapest Option?

No. Even when your organization qualifies for group pricing, I would compare exactly what the group ticket includes and what your group needs.

A Disney Imagination Campus ticket can make excellent sense for a qualifying school or youth organization, especially when the trip also includes an educational workshop or performance opportunity.

But a normal family group doesn’t need to create a complicated group booking simply to save money. In that situation, current Disney promotions or legitimate discounted tickets may be the better route.

What About Educational Workshops and Performances?

Disney Imagination Campus is more than a discounted-ticket program.

Qualifying student groups can add separately priced educational experiences covering areas such as STEM, leadership, storytelling and performing arts.

The participant requirement can be higher for an individual workshop than it is for the basic student-ticket program. For example, some Disneyland performing arts workshops require 15 students, while certain instrumental programs require 20 performers.

That’s likely where some of the older advice about needing 15 or more people originates. It should not be confused with the current 10-student minimum for Disney Student Tickets themselves.
